This video is to give the proof for so-called Heron’s formula and Brahmagupta's formula, which enable us to calculate the areas of given triangle and inscribed quadrangle in a circle respectively simply from the lengths of their sides. These theorem are quite famous and actually useless at the same time, which is all the more why they are famous, I guess. Anyway, the proofs themselves are kinda fun, so just enjoy.
